The TUREWELL Water Flossing Oral Irrigator is a powerful dental cleaner featuring up to 1700 water pulses per minute and 10 adjustable pressure settings (30-125 PSI) to deeply clean teeth and gums, especially effective for braces and implants. It includes 8 specialized jet tips for comprehensive family use, a large 600ml water tank with anti-leak design, and user-friendly controls with a 3-minute smart timer, delivering professional-grade oral care at home.

You get more tips plus..
You get more tips with this one plus improvements. I had the previous model, the Habor, and got 6 years out of it with using it daily and sometimes twice a day. When it started to squeal, that was the end. I researched the company and found they still made them but gave them a new name and design and called it Turewell. My old Habor was black. What I don't like about this new one is that if I leave it plugged in, I cannot hang it safely upside down on the towel rack over the sink like my Habor to drain. I will either have to unplug it each time after use that they recommend or put it somewhere nearby so it can't fall into the sink. Also with the new one, it will shut off after 3 minutes but I use a pretty good stream so the unit is empty before the three minutes are up. If that happens while underway, just turn the knob off as they say in the booklet and then back on again. With my old one it was directed to leave upside down to drain but with this one there is nothing said about this at all. I will just leave it upside down on a dry wash cloth away from the sink but it may not matter. No problem with pressure but always when starting out, press gently on the reservoir so it can prime properly. I also noticed with both units, it helps to move the hose around up and down to get it going to that good stream as it may or may not help it prime. Also I once tossed a perfectly good Water Pic because I did not press down on the reservoir. I think all flossers are like this. They do mention it in the manual for the Turewell. It does make a difference to change to a new tip once in a while that I never did in 6 years. I think the calcium in the water here makes the stream more restricted. They give you three tips of the standard one that most people use and one of each of the specialty ones. OK but with caveats
OK But.... this water flosser id OK for the price - but make no mistake, the water pik is a better machine - why? the waterpik has an on/off button - you don't need to reset the water pressure each time you start the machine (the truewell's on and off is part of the water pressure mechanism - meaning you have to find your sweet spot each time you use the machine). The waterpik has way better pressure- - i have to turn the truwell almost all the way to max to achieve the same pressure my water pic had at about 1/2 on the dial. Also the water pic feel like a more quality item - better fit and finish - for longevity i can't say - my last water pik lasted about 3-4 years with 2x a day use- finally gave up the ghost as of course these things are constantly getting bathed in water -again for less than 1/2 the price the turewell seems fine - but if i had to purchase again i'd proably just but the more expensive waterpik
